A remote IoT VPC (Virtual Private Cloud) functions as a virtual network within a cloud provider's infrastructure. Think of it as a private, secure playground, allowing your smart gadgets to interact without exposing sensitive data to the public internet. This isolation is crucial for safeguarding data and mitigating potential security risks.

At its core, a VPC allows you to define your own IP address range, configure routing tables, and set up security groups to meticulously control access to your resources. This level of control is what truly sets VPCs apart, making them the cornerstone of secure and efficient IoT deployments.

Let's explore the essential concepts and components of a remote IoT VPC. The first key concept is the VPC itself. A VPC is essentially a dedicated network environment that isolates your resources from other cloud users. This isolation is paramount for creating a secure and scalable infrastructure for your IoT deployments. Organizations can create a secure and scalable infrastructure for their IoT deployments by leveraging VPCs.

Understanding the components of a VPC is essential for configuring remote IoT VPC SSH effectively:

  • IP Address Range: Defining a private IP address range within your VPC is the initial step. This is the foundation upon which your private network will be built.
  • Subnets: Subnets are logical divisions within your IP address range. They allow you to segment your network and control traffic flow more granularly.
  • Routing Tables: Routing tables dictate how network traffic is directed between subnets and other networks, which is crucial for connectivity.
  • Security Groups: Security groups act as virtual firewalls, controlling the inbound and outbound traffic for your resources. They are fundamental for security.
  • Internet Gateway: If you require access to the public internet from your VPC, an internet gateway is used.
